washstand

noun
wash·​stand | \ ˈwȯsh-ËŒstand How to pronounce washstand (audio) , ˈwäsh-\

Definition of washstand

1 : a stand holding articles needed for washing one's face and hands
2 : a washbowl permanently set in place and attached to water and drainpipes

First Known Use of washstand

1789, in the meaning defined at sense 1
